Overview of 2017 Mercedes-Benz GLS450 For Sale by Owner

Do you want a large luxury SUV that's a Mercedes-Benz? If so, you're in luck. The GLS-Class is the biggest SUV to come from the Stuttgart squad, and as you'd expect, it's suitably spacious. Introduced in 2006 as the GL-Class, it became the GLS in 2015 and hasn't looked back ever since. And neither will you if you choose to purchase this 2017 Mercedes-Benz GLS450 from us. Yes, it's got over 113,000 miles on the odometer, but these cars are meant to be driven. They baulk at high mileage. So you can easily expect to double or even triple this reading. It's even got the Technology Package included.

Exterior and Interior

Wearing a suave black coat, this 2017 Mercedes-Benz GLS450 is certainly a vehicle that will elicit a second look from those who know their cars. Alternatively, it won't attract unnecessary attention, allowing you to go about your business in peace. Exterior highlights include projector headlamps, prominent Mercedes-Benz Star emblems, and double-five-spoke alloy wheels. Venture aboard this 2017 Mercedes-Benz GLS450, and you'll find a seven-seat passenger cabin with beige leather plus Wood Poplar interior trim. As a pinnacle luxury SUV, you've got plenty of tech toys. Let's start with the tri-zone climate control that keeps everyone comfortable. Then, we have a decent infotainment system, replete with a CD player, hooked up to a premium sound system. Meanwhile, the front seats are power-adjustable, with heating and memory functions. You'll also find a clear analog instrument cluster flanking a color screen to display a myriad of information. You've even got a panoramic sliding glass roof for acres of sky at your command. As for the trunk, its suitably spacious, and you can fold down the third row for even more capacity. If that's still not enough, the second row can be folded too, and you've got yourself a U-Haul, basically. However, you'll want to avoid carrying messy or dirty items lest you spoil the luxurious interior of this 2017 Mercedes-Benz GLS450.

Engine

Sporting a sensible powertrain under the hood, this 2017 Mercedes-Benz GLS450 relies on a twin-turbocharged 3.0L V6 to move it along. With 362hp and 369lb-ft, it can move along rather nicely, aided by the 9G-TRONIC nine-speed automatic transmission and 4MATIC all-wheel drive system. You'll also find the latest safety features, such as blind spot assist, ready to help you when driving this large vehicle down the roads of America.

The Mercedes-Benz SL-Class has long represented the brand’s vision of the ultimate personal luxury roadster, combining sports car performance with the refinement of a grand touring coupe. Introduced for the 2003 model year, the R230-generation SL brought a new era of technology to the legendary SL nameplate, replacing the traditional soft top with an innovative retractable power hardtop that could transform the car from a sleek coupe into an open-air roadster at the touch of a button. This 2004 Mercedes-Benz SL 500 carries that formula forward with its timeless design, advanced engineering, and naturally aspirated V8 power. Showing approximately 123,845 miles, this example is finished in Fire Opal Red Unilac over a Beige interior and is equipped with desirable features including AMG Double-Spoke 18-inch wheels, Keyless-GO, COMAND navigation, Bose premium audio, and heated front seats. At the heart of the SL 500 is Mercedes-Benz’s highly regarded 5.0L M113 V8, delivering the smooth, effortless performance that made the SL-Class a benchmark among luxury grand tourers. Designed for drivers who appreciate both craftsmanship and capability, this SL 500 represents an era when Mercedes-Benz combined advanced technology, elegant styling, and traditional V8 character into one sophisticated roadster.
